    NORAD ID: 25544
    Int'l Code: 1998-067A
    Perigee: 356.7 km
    Apogee: 367.3 km
    Inclination: 51.6°
    Period: 91.6 min
    Semi major axis: 6,733.0 km
    Launch date: November 20, 1998
    Source: International Space Station (ISS)
    Comments: The International Space Station (ISS) is a joint project of five space agencies: the National Aeronautics and Space Administration (United States), the Russian Federal Space Agency (Russian Federation), the Japan Aerospace Exploration Agency (Japan), the Canadian Space Agency (Canada) and the European Space Agency (Europe). It is serviced primarily by the Soyuz, Progress spacecraft units and Space Shuttle. The ISS is currently still under construction with a projected completion date of 2010.
